React.purecomponent hook
Web我一直在學習React 16.8的新功能。 我相信React的Pure Component應該自動避免不必要的重新渲染操作。 在以下示例中, App本身是無狀態組件。 我使用useState來維護兩個狀態對象text和nested: {text} 。 有3個測試。 前兩個測試工作。 WebFeatures. Only what you need and nothing more. No Redux. No React Native. Simply, simple React snippets. These snippets were selected carefully from my own day-to-day React use. Not everything in React is included here. This is a hand selected set of snippets that work the way that you would expect, not just a copy of the documentation.
React.purecomponent hook
Did you know?
WebApr 14, 2024 · This hook automatically handles adding and removing the event listener when the component mounts and unmounts, ensuring proper cleanup. Conclusion: 10 Clever … WebUsing a render prop can negate the advantage that comes from using React.PureComponentif you create the function inside a rendermethod. This is because the shallow prop comparison will always return falsefor new props, and each renderin this case will generate a new value for the render prop.
WebYou might want to extract the expensive parts to separate components and use React.memo or React.PureComponent to minimize re-renders for them. Using with class component You can wrap your class component in a function component to use the hook: class Profile extends React.Component { render() { // Get it from props WebDec 23, 2024 · If you are unfamiliar with how the useState hook works in React, I suggest you check out my blog post on it here! Get to Know the UseState Hook in React.js. Because functional components are awesome. ... As React.PureComponent uses shallow comparison to determine when to rerender, we must have discipline when creating and …
WebApr 13, 2024 · The useEffect hook is used to log a message to the console when the component is mounted and to return a cleanup function that logs a message to the console when the component is unmounted. ... Use React.PureComponent: PureComponent is a component that implements shouldComponentUpdate() by default. It performs a shallow … http://geekdaxue.co/read/dashuz@vodc7g/kt45xq
WebPureComponent is a subclass of Component and supports all the Component APIs. Extending PureComponent is equivalent to defining a custom shouldComponentUpdate …
WebAug 7, 2024 · Extending React Class Components with Pure Components ensures the higher performance of the Component and ultimately makes your application faster, While in the … cinnamon soluble fiberWebJan 27, 2024 · As mentioned already, the React team has not yet implemented a hook equivalent, and there are no published timelines for a hook implementation. A few third party packages on npm implement error boundary hooks. This is the most popular npm package. diakonia west ocean cityWebMar 7, 2024 · A React component can be considered pure if it renders the same output for the same state and props. We can convert component to pure component as below: For … diakonie community nursediakonie am campus hof scheltersWebFeb 28, 2024 · You are using the wrong method here, React.memo is the equivalent of React.PureComponent. React.useMemo is used to memoize expensive computations … cinnamon soft pretzels recipeWebDec 29, 2024 · Instead, you can extend PureComponent or implement shouldComponentUpdate() method. Use React Memo in your application. Now that you know all about React Memo, let’s dive into creating a React application that actually uses it. But first, take a look at its syntax: const MyComponent = React. memo (function … diakonia thrift store ocean city mdWebMorning Star Fishing, West Ocean City, Maryland. 5,104 likes · 11 talking about this · 681 were here. Join Captain Monty Hawkins aboard The Party Boat that Fishes Like a Private … cinnamons oahu hawaii